BRC No. | RBRC11390 |
Type | Targeted Mutation Congenic |
Species | Mus musculus |
Strain name | B6.Cg-Cxcl12<tm4.1Tng> |
Former Common name | Cxcl12-flox |
H-2 Haplotype | |
ES Cell line | KY1.1[(C57BL/6J x 129S6/SvEvTac)F1] |
Background strain | |
Appearance | |
Strain development | Deposited by Takashi Nagasawa, Osaka University in 2021. This strain was generated using KY1.1 ES cells derived from 129/B6. Mice were further backcrossed to C57BL/6J for 10 generations. C57BL/6J congenic line. |
Strain description | Cxcl12-flox mouse. Exon 2 of the Cxcl12 gene is floxed by a pair of loxP. |
